i bought my web hosting from this website and I must say they are the best. my website was up and running in under 24 hours. Their security features are also something to appreciate because they make it a priority. their customer service is excellent. I'm a very happy client recommending this website to everyone.
3 years ago
Eltris.com has a
5.0
average rating
from
1,211
reviews